CALL FOR AN ORDINARY AND EXTRAORDINARY GENERAL SHAREHOLDERS’ MEETING AND CLASS “A” AND CLASS “D” SHARES SPECIAL SHAREHOLDERS’ MEETINGS OF TELECOM ARGENTINA S.A.
The Shareholders of Telecom Argentina S.A. (“Telecom Argentina” or “the Company”) are summoned to an Ordinary and Extraordinary General Shareholders’ Meeting and Class “A” and Class “D” shares Special Shareholders’ Meetings to be held on April 25, 2025, at 11 a.m. Buenos Aires Time on the first call, and at 12 p.m. Buenos Aires Time on the second call to deliberate upon the agenda of the Ordinary Shareholders’ Meeting, by personal attendance at the corporate offices at General Hornos No. 690, Ground Floor, City of Buenos Aires, in order to consider the following items:
AGENDA
1) | Appoint of two shareholders to sign the Minutes of the Meeting. |
2) | Consider the documentation required by Law No. 19,550 section 234 subsection 1, the Comisión Nacional de Valores (“CNV”) Rules, and the Bolsas y Mercados Argentinos (“BYMA”) Listing Rules, as well as the financial documentation in English required by the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ission’s rules and regulations, for the Company’s thirty-sixth fiscal year, ended December 31, 2024 (“Fiscal Year 2024”). |
3) | Consider the Retained Earnings as of December 31, 2024, which reported a positive balance of AR$1,012,403,588,560. Proposal to: (i) Allocate AR$50,620,179,428 to establish the Legal Reserve; ii) Allocate AR$961,783,409,132 to the “Voluntary reserve to maintain the capital investments level and the Company’s current level of solvency”. (iii) Reclassify the amount of AR$93,077,304,540 from the account “Voluntary reserve to maintain the capital investments level and the Company’s current level of solvency” (which will amount, as a consequence, to AR$1,164,365,049,990) by charging that amount to the account “Contributed Surplus”, which, after giving effect to such reclassification, will total AR$2,488,650,848,653. (iv) Submit for the consideration of the Shareholders’ Meeting the delegation of powers to the Board of Directors in order to totally or partially withdraw the “Voluntary reserve to maintain the capital investments level and the Company’s current level of solvency” and to distribute dividends in cash or in kind or any combination of both options. |
4) | Consider the performance of Members of the Board of Directors and Members of the Supervisory Committee who have served during the Fiscal Year 2024. |
5) | Consider the compensation for the Board of Directors corresponding to the Fiscal Year 2024. Proposal to pay the total amount of AR$3,574,607,443, representing 0.37% of the accountable earnings, calculated according to CNV Rules Title II, Chapter III, section 3. |
6) | Authorize the Board of Directors to pay advances on fees to those Directors who during fiscal year to end December 31, 2025 (“Fiscal Year 2025”) serve as independent directors or perform technical-administrative tasks or perform special assignments (within the guidelines determined by the General Corporations Law and contingent upon what the Shareholders’ Meeting resolves). |
7) | Consider the compensation to Members of the Supervisory Committee corresponding to the Fiscal Year 2024. Proposal to pay the total amount of AR$328,782,707. |
8) | Authorize the Board of Directors to pay advances on fees to those Members of the Supervisory Committee who serve during the Fiscal Year 2025 (contingent upon what the Shareholders´ Meeting resolves). |
9) | Elect five (5) regular Members of the Supervisory Committee to serve during the Fiscal Year 2025. |
10) | Determine the number of alternate Members of the Supervisory Committee to serve during the Fiscal Year 2025 and elect them. |
11) | Determine the compensation of the Independent Auditors who served during the Fiscal Year 2024. |
12) | Appoint the Independent Auditors of the financial statements for the Fiscal Year 2025. |
13) | Determine the compensation Independent Auditors of the financial statements for the Fiscal Year 2025. |
14) | Consider the budget for the Audit Committee for the Fiscal Year 2025 (AR$188,131,000). |
15) | Consider of the corporate reorganization through which Telecom Argentina, as absorbing and continuing company, will merge with its controlled companies Negocios y Servicios S.A.U. (“NYSSA”) and AVC Continente Audiovisual S.A. (“AVC”) (hereinafter, the “Corporate Reorganization” or the “Reorganization”), effective January 1st, 2025, in compliance with sections 82 and subsequent of the General Corporate Law, sections 80 and subsequent of the Income Tax Law and the CNV Rules. Consider of the Individual Special Merger Financial Situation Statement of Telecom Argentina and the Consolidated Special Merger Financial Situation Statement of Telecom Argentina, AVC and NYSSA, both as from December 31, 2024, with their respective reports of the Supervisory Committees, syndic and of the Independent Auditors. Consider the Preliminary Merger Agreement entered into by Telecom Argentina, AVC and NYSSA on February 27, 2025. Subscribe to the Final Merger Agreement. Grant authorizations to request to the regulatory entities any necessary approvals and authorizations and to perform all due submissions and procedures to obtain the corresponding registrations. |

I. | OPINION ON THE PROPOSAL FOR BOARD OF DIRECTORS’ FEES FOR THE FISCAL YEAR 2024 AND ADVANCE FEE PAYMENTS TO DIRECTORS SERVING IN THE FISCAL YEAR 2025 |
The proposal submitted by the Board is to allocate to the Directors of Telecom Argentina who served in the fiscal year 2024 (from January 1, 2024, to December 31, 2024), a total compensation of AR$3,574,607,443.00, for all their duties, proposing that the General Meeting delegate on the Board the distribution of that amount among its members.
After exchanging ideas, the Audit Committee UNANIMOUSLY approves the amount of fees to be allocated to the abovementioned Directors of Telecom Argentina S.A. To that end, the Audit Committee has taken into consideration the following criteria to support such approval:
a) | The roles that have been performed by the members on the Board and the different Committees; |
b) | The responsibilities assigned and assumed, and the representation of the Company and its subsidiaries abroad; |
c) | The specific dedication to their functions as part of the Governing Body, and the value added to the business for the technical tasks performed during the year; |
d) | The provisions of article 261 of the General Corporations Law No. 19,550, and the compensation nature of the functions assigned, as well as the provisions of CNV Rules Chapter III Title II; |
e) | The experience of Board members in their roles as well as the track record, professional experience and reputation of Directors who will receive said fees; |
f) | The roles of Chairman and Vice-Chairman during the year under review, and the technical and administrative tasks fulfilled; |
g) | The added value of additional functions carried out by some Members of the Board on several committees (Executive Committee, Audit Committee), requiring a specific professional profile, spending many hours of work, and involving tasks of high responsibility; |
h) | The exclusive service of the Directors who are part of the Audit Committee, who do not participate in other Audit Committees in the market; |
i) | The Company’s business volume, and strategic decisions made by this body and the challenges associated with the function; |
j) | The proportionality, coherence and correlation of the proposal to be made to the Shareholders’ Meeting with those submitted in previous fiscal years, considering the global context and the high adaptability to new situations and permanent challenges faced by the market where the Company operates; |
k) | The market behavior of publicly traded companies that are listed both on Argentine and U.S. Stock Exchanges. |
Therefore, based on the above, the Audit Committee UNANIMOUSLY resolves:
1) | To approve said amount, considering the tasks performed, the general context, and the fact that said amount is reasonable and adequate in terms of market conditions for similar companies, and does not involve any infringement of any legal, regulatory, or statutory provisions applicable to the Company. |
2) | To approve the proposal to empower the Board to make advance payments for fees to the Directors that will serve during the fiscal year 2025 (contingent upon the Shareholders’ Meeting decision that considers the documentation for the fiscal year 2025). |
3) | To delegate to the Chairman the communication of this resolution to the Board of Directors, as well as the signing of the pertinent documentation. |
II. | OPINION ON THE PROPOSAL FOR INDEPENDENT AUDITORS’S FEES FOR THE FISCAL YEAR 2024 |
The Audit Committee considers the proposal to pay PwC for its services as External Auditors of the Financial Statements of Telecom Argentina S.A. for the fiscal year 2024 the sum of AR$1,321,871,000.00 (which does not include VAT), broken down into AR$903,131,100.00 for financial statements audit tasks and AR$418,740,000.00 for the audit activities performed in connection with the certification under Section 404 of the Sarbanes Oxley Act.
After an analysis by its members, the Audit Committee considers that the proposed fees are reasonably appropriate to the magnitude, importance and quality of the task carried out and within the range of fees approved by other listed companies with similar characteristics to Telecom Argentina.
To reach this conclusion, the Audit Committee has considered the complexity of the task, and the specialization required to perform the audit activities developed by the External Auditors in relation to the certification of Section 404 of the Sarbanes-Oxley Act. Therefore, the Audit Committee unanimously concludes that the fees that the Board of Directors will propose to the Meeting as remuneration for the performance of such activities are equally reasonable, and UNANIMOUSLY approves said proposal.
III. | OPINION ON THE PROPOSAL TO APPOINT EXTERNAL AUDITORS FOR THE FISCAL YEAR 2025 |
Regarding the proposal for the appointment of Independent External Auditors of the Financial Statements of Telecom Argentina for the fiscal year 2025, the Board of Directors is planning to propose to the Annual General Shareholder’s Meeting the appointment of the firm Price Waterhouse & Co. as Independent External Auditors of the financial statements of Telecom Argentina for the year ended December 31, 2025. The account will continue to be led by CPA Alejandro Javier Rosa as the certifying accountant and CPAs Sergio Reinaldo Cravero and Ezequiel Luis Mirazón as his alternates.
The Audit Committee, under the specific provisions of CNV Rules —substantiated opinion required by articles 25 and 28 of Section VI, Chapter III, Title II of the CNV Rules (N.T. 2013 and amendments)— has carried out a review of the background and performance of PwC, which is also the current provider of independent auditing services of Telecom Argentina S.A.
In this regard, the review of PwC’s profile carried out by the Audit Committee was based on:
· | The composition of both the firm’s work teams, including both the audit and support teams, at both national and international levels, evidencing in-depth knowledge of the business systems and processes, and particularly of the financial reporting process. |
· | The knowledge of the firm and associated companies. |
· | The assessment of their performance, based on the Audit Committee’s activities of annual oversight and evaluation of Independent Auditors, whose essential objective is to achieve reliability in the financial information that the Company provides to control entities, investors, and markets. |
· | The profile of PwC as a firm of local and international recognized prestige, with a vast and outstanding professional record, and with procedures that meet stringent levels of quality and independence at its audited companies. |
· | The firm’s sound knowledge of the business of Telecom Argentina S.A., and of its administrative systems and control structure. |
Therefore, the Audit Committee, based on the background of the proposed firm, its performance in previous years and the abovementioned considerations, UNANIMOUSLY resolves to submit to the Board of Directors a favorable opinion on the proposal to appoint PwC as Independent External Auditors for the fiscal year 2025.
IV. | AUDIT COMMITTEE EXPENSES – 2024 REPORT AND 2025 BUDGET |
The Board of Directors has also requested the Audit Committee to report the amount of expenses incurred in its operation, functioning and training activities during the fiscal year 2024. Said total expenses have amounted to AR$44,187,993.00, of an originally approved budget of AR$127,958,619.00.
The Audit Committee was also asked to provide a forecast of the resources estimated to perform its duties during the fiscal year 2025, so as to request the General Meeting to approve the corresponding budget.
On this topic, Mr. Cazzasa submits a report on the expenses incurred by the Committee during the fiscal year 2024 and budgetary period. The Committee members review the different items of the report.
Continuing with discussions concerning the budget, in view of the activities performed during the previous fiscal year, the regulatory training and advisory needs estimated for the current year, the hiring of adequate services required for the effective performance of its duties and responsibilities, and the advisability of maintaining an adequate financial autonomy, as well as the general evolution of costs, the members of the Audit Committee conclude UNANIMOUSLY on the convenience to request the Shareholders’ Meeting to approve an operating budget of AR$188,131,000.00 for the fiscal year 2025. Said amount is consistent with the amounts budgeted using the currency of August 2024, adjusted by inflation as estimated by Telecom, at the currency of each of the months in which the expenditure is estimated to be made in 2025.
